1. What is a Software Engineer at Aareal Bank?

A Software Engineer at Aareal Bank plays a pivotal role in the digital transformation of one of the leading international property specialists. You are not just writing code; you are building the robust, secure, and scalable infrastructure that powers complex financial transactions and real estate banking solutions. Your work directly influences how the bank manages its digital footprint, maintains compliance, and delivers value to institutional clients across the globe.

Whether you are working within the specialized ABAP environment for core banking systems, driving Cloud Governance to ensure secure and efficient infrastructure, or contributing to high-impact development summits, your technical contributions are foundational to the bank's operational success. This role offers the unique opportunity to operate at the intersection of traditional finance and modern software engineering, requiring both technical precision and a deep understanding of the regulatory environment in which Aareal Bank operates.

3. Getting Ready for Your Interviews

Success at Aareal Bank requires a balanced approach. You must demonstrate that you are not only a capable engineer but also a professional who respects the rigors of the banking industry.

Role-related knowledge – You must be prepared to discuss your mastery of the technologies listed in your profile, whether it is ABAP, cloud architecture, or software engineering best practices. Interviewers will look for evidence that you can apply these skills to solve real-world banking problems rather than just theoretical exercises.

Problem-solving ability – You will be evaluated on your ability to break down complex, ambiguous requirements into actionable technical tasks. Be ready to walk your interviewer through your logic, showing them how you weigh trade-offs between speed, security, and scalability.

Culture fit and professional maturityAareal Bank values reliability, transparency, and collaboration. Show that you can work effectively with diverse teams and that you understand the importance of compliance and risk management in your daily development work.

6. Key Responsibilities

As a Software Engineer, your day-to-day work involves more than just coding. You will collaborate closely with product owners and internal stakeholders to define requirements that balance innovation with the bank’s stringent risk-management policies. You will be responsible for the full development lifecycle, from initial design and implementation to testing and deployment in controlled environments.

In roles like Cloud Governance, your responsibilities extend to defining and enforcing standards that keep the bank's infrastructure secure. You will work on projects that are often long-term in nature, requiring a mindset that favors sustainable, well-documented solutions over quick fixes. Expect to participate in cross-functional meetings where your technical input helps shape the bank's digital roadmaps.

7. Role Requirements & Qualifications

A competitive candidate for a Software Engineer position at Aareal Bank brings a mix of deep technical expertise and professional diligence.

  • Must-have skills: Proficient knowledge of the relevant stack (e.g., ABAP for core systems or Cloud/Governance frameworks), strong analytical skills, and a commitment to high-quality documentation.
  • Nice-to-have skills: Experience within the financial services sector, knowledge of regulatory requirements in banking, and familiarity with agile development methodologies.
  • Soft skills: Clear communication, the ability to work in a structured environment, and a proactive approach to problem-solving.

9. Other General Tips

  • Structure your answers: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) for behavioral questions to keep your responses concise and impactful.
  • Know your resume: Be prepared to discuss any project in detail, especially those involving complex problem-solving or cross-team collaboration.
  • Ask meaningful questions: Use the end of your interview to ask about the team's current challenges or how they balance innovation with security.
